1986 Chateau Trotanoy, Pomerol, Bottle (750ml)
1986 is not a particularly strong vintage for Pomerol, but the 86 Trotanoy has really turned out quite well indeed. The wine is again a bit more black fruity than many vintages of Trot, wafting from the glass in a complex melange of dark plums, black cherries, sweet Cuban tobacco, a lovely base of soil, dark chocolate, woodsmoke and a touch of oak. On the palate the wine is deep, full-bodied, complex and very refined, with a slight dip in the mid-palate, but excellent focus and grip, very modest tannins and a fine, persistent finish. I would be delighted to drink the 86 Trotanoy on any occasion, as it is an eminently satisfying glass of nearly mature Pomerol. (JR)" (July 2016)
